Manager Training in Schleswig-Holstein, Germany
Many managers are promoted for technical ability, not for managing people. Without clear training, they are expected to handle performance, communication, accountability, and priorities through trial and error. This program helps managers build the skills they need to lead people effectively, set expectations clearly, and support consistent execution.
The training is practical and role focused. Managers learn tools they can use immediately in real workplace situations, not abstract leadership theory.
